  • Magnificent reliefs and hieroglyps on the second pylon at the Temple of Isis at Philae (Agilqiyya Island). The temple, dating from the 30th Dynasty, is one of the best preserved Ptolemaic temples in Egypt. Originally sitting on the east bank of the River Nile, the temple was relocated to higher land on the island of Agilqiyyah in the early 1970's after the construction of the Aswan High Dam.
